Sony Ericsson J300




Design Sony Ericsson J300
Form factor:
Candybar
Dimensions:
3.90 x 1.70 x 0.70 inches (99.1 x 42.6 x 18.2 mm)
Weight:
2.80 oz (78 g)
the average is 4.8 oz (137 g)
Design features:
Numeric keypad, Exchangable faceplates
Display Sony Ericsson J300
Screen Resolution:?Screen resolution refers to the size of the image received on the screen in pixels
128 x 128 pixels
Technology:
TFT
Colors:
65 536
Hardware Sony Ericsson J300
Built-in storage:
0.012 GB
Battery Sony Ericsson J300
Talk time:
7.00 hours
the average is 11 h (675 min)
Stand-by time:
12.5 days (300 hours)
the average is 20 days (477 h)
Type:
Li - Ion
Internet browsing Sony Ericsson J300
Browser supports:
WAP 2.0
Technology Sony Ericsson J300
GSM:
850, 1900 MHz
Data:
GPRS
Phone features Sony Ericsson J300
Phonebook:
Picture ID
Organizer:
Calculator, Timer, Stopwatch, Alarm, To-Do, Calendar
Messaging:
SMS, Predictive text input (T9), MMS
Instant Messaging:
Yes
Games:
Yes
Connectivity Sony Ericsson J300
USB:?Universal Serial Bus
Yes
Other:
Computer sync, SyncML
Other features Sony Ericsson J300
Notifications:
Polyphonic ringtones (40 voices), Vibration, Speakerphone
Voice recording
Regulatory Approval Sony Ericsson J300
FCC approval :
 
Date approved:
30 Jun 2005
FCC ID value: PY7A1041021
FCC measured SAR :
 
Head:
0.88 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z
Body:
1.02 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z
Availability Sony Ericsson J300
Officially announced:
01 Mar 2005
